If ACC doesn't start with an error or the executable is missing, please add your entire Steam directory to the exceptions in your antivirus software, run a Steam integrity check or reinstall the game altogether. Make sure you add the User/Documents/Assetto Corsa Competizione folder to your antivirus/Defender exceptions and exclude it from any file sharing app (GDrive, OneDrive or Dropbox)! The Corsair iCue software is also known to conflict with Input Device initialization, if the game does not start up and you have such devices, please try disabling the iCue software and try again. [file:unknown] [line: 95] secure crt: invalid error is a sign of antivirus interference, while [Pak chunk signing mismatch on chunk] indicates a corrupted installation that requires game file verification.

    That has absolutely nothing to do with it. For some people (which are racing, too) drifting is the biggest pleasure. A buddy and I started drifting our Karts at the age of 13 when it was wet or in the winter on hard slicks. Back then we didn't even know the word drift.
    The first few times (on the last run of the day) we went out on slicks in the wet because it is the best school for the "sensors". And we noticed that it was the most fun to go sideways from corner entry till exit.
